1. Introduction to URL Shortening
URL shortening is a way on-line where an extended URL is usually transformed right into a shorter, extra manageable sort. This shortened URL redirects to the original lengthy URL when visited. Companies like Bitly and TinyURL are very well-acknowledged samples of URL shorteners. The need for URL shortening arose with the appearance of social media marketing platforms like Twitter, where character boundaries for posts designed it tough to share prolonged URLs.

Outside of social networking, URL shorteners are valuable in advertising strategies, e-mail, and printed media exactly where very long URLs may be cumbersome.

2. Main Factors of the URL Shortener
A URL shortener normally includes the subsequent factors:

World-wide-web Interface: Here is the front-stop portion wherever people can enter their long URLs and obtain shortened versions. It may be an easy sort with a Online page.
Databases: A databases is essential to shop the mapping in between the first lengthy URL along with the shortened version. Databases like MySQL, PostgreSQL, or NoSQL options like MongoDB can be used.
Redirection Logic: Here is the backend logic that can take the quick URL and redirects the user on the corresponding lengthy URL. This logic will likely be carried out in the web server or an software layer.
API: Many URL shorteners provide an API to ensure that 3rd-bash applications can programmatically shorten URLs and retrieve the first prolonged URLs.
three. Coming up with the URL Shortening Algorithm
The crux of a URL shortener lies in its algorithm for changing a long URL into a brief one particular. A number of methods can be used, which include:

Hashing: The lengthy URL could be hashed into a hard and fast-sizing string, which serves given that the brief URL. On the other hand, hash collisions (distinctive URLs causing exactly the same hash) have to be managed.
Base62 Encoding: A person frequent method is to work with Base62 encoding (which makes use of sixty two people: 0-nine, A-Z, in addition to a-z) on an integer ID. The ID corresponds for the entry while in the databases. This technique ensures that the shorter URL is as small as feasible.
Random String Technology: Yet another tactic would be to make a random string of a set length (e.g., 6 characters) and Verify if it’s presently in use while in the databases. Otherwise, it’s assigned for the extensive URL.
four. Databases Administration
The database schema for any URL shortener is normally easy, with two primary fields:

ID: A novel identifier for each URL entry.
Long URL: The first URL that needs to be shortened.
Brief URL/Slug: The shorter Model in the URL, usually saved as a unique string.
Along with these, you might want to retailer metadata such as the development date, expiration day, and the amount of situations the short URL has actually been accessed.

5. Managing Redirection
Redirection can be a crucial Element of the URL shortener's operation. When a user clicks on a short URL, the service should rapidly retrieve the initial URL from the database and redirect the person making use of an HTTP 301 (everlasting redirect) or 302 (temporary redirect) standing code.

Overall performance is key in this article, as the method should be virtually instantaneous. Methods like databases indexing and caching (e.g., using Redis or Memcached) might be used to speed up the retrieval approach.

six. Security Things to consider
Protection is a substantial worry in URL shorteners:

Destructive URLs: A URL shortener can be abused to unfold destructive links. Employing URL validation, blacklisting, or integrating with 3rd-bash security providers to examine URLs right before shortening them can mitigate this danger.
Spam Prevention: Fee restricting and CAPTCHA can reduce abuse by spammers attempting to create 1000s of small URLs.
seven. Scalability
Given that the URL shortener grows, it may need to handle countless URLs and redirect requests. This requires a scalable architecture, perhaps involving load balancers, distributed databases, and microservices.

Load Balancing: Distribute site visitors across several servers to deal with large loads.
Distributed Databases: Use databases that can scale horizontally, like Cassandra or MongoDB.
Microservices: Separate fears like URL shortening, analytics, and redirection into distinctive products and services to further improve scalability and maintainability.
eight. Analytics
URL shorteners typically supply analytics to track how frequently a brief URL is clicked, in which the site visitors is coming from, along with other helpful metrics. This requires logging Each individual redirect And perhaps integrating with analytics platforms.

9. Summary
Developing a URL shortener includes a blend of frontend and backend enhancement, database administration, and a focus to security and scalability. Though it could seem like a straightforward support, creating a sturdy, efficient, and safe URL shortener presents various difficulties and necessitates mindful planning and execution. No matter if you’re producing it for private use, internal corporation tools, or for a public provider, understanding the underlying rules and ideal procedures is important for good results.
